Associations of Sleep Pattern and Genetic Risk with Late-Onset Psoriasis: A Large Prospective Cohort Study

Poor sleep significantly increases psoriasis risk, especially in women. Genetic predisposition further elevates this risk, highlighting the interplay between sleep patterns and genetics in psoriasis development.
Area of Science:
- Dermatology and Sleep Medicine
Background:
- Sleep disturbances are increasingly recognized as potential contributors to various health conditions.
- The interplay between sleep patterns, genetic predisposition, and the risk of developing psoriasis remains underexplored.
Purpose of the Study:
- To investigate the association between sleep disturbance and incident psoriasis risk.
- To examine the interaction effect of sleep patterns and genetic risk on psoriasis development.
Main Methods:
- A prospective cohort study involving over 500,000 participants from the UK Biobank (2006-2010).
- Sleep patterns were assessed based on chronotype, duration, insomnia, snoring, and daytime sleepiness.
- A weighted genetic risk score for psoriasis was constructed and categorized.
- Interaction effects between sleep patterns and genetic risk factors were analyzed.
Main Results:
- Poor sleep patterns were significantly associated with a higher risk of incident psoriasis (HR=1.656).
- This association was more pronounced in female participants (HR=2.050).
- The combined effect of high genetic risk and poor sleep significantly increased psoriasis risk (HR=3.620).
- An interaction effect between sleep pattern and genetic risk was detected, with population attributable fractions comparable for both factors.
Conclusions:
- Poor sleep is a significant risk factor for developing psoriasis, particularly in women.
- Genetic predisposition and sleep patterns interact to influence psoriasis risk.
- Addressing sleep disturbances may be a potential strategy for psoriasis prevention, especially in genetically susceptible individuals.
